Tagoor Tejavath
5.0
IIMC - Indian Institute of Management, Master of Business Administration [MBA]
Reviewed on Nov 28, 2022(Enrolled 2019)

Placement Experience:

Students are eligible for campus placements from the fifth term. 300+ companies visit the campus to recruit 500 students. The highest package is 70LPA and the Average package is 20LPA. 100% placements. after getting the degree students will join the recruited companies.
